Output 1a63dcea5cf4e758438c7da91d4a10dce8b23c2acb564a07c7efa04c17f0fe66:0

value
2308459
script pubkey
OP_0 OP_PUSHBYTES_20 9d20514ee488773f920398403c9a7939da00132e
address
bc1qn5s9znhy3pmnlysrnpqrexne88dqqyewhp927y
transaction
1a63dcea5cf4e758438c7da91d4a10dce8b23c2acb564a07c7efa04c17f0fe66
confirmations
182952
spent
true